This revised edition covers copyright issues in further and higher education libraries. It is an amalgamation of two previous LA guides, "Copyright in Polytechnic and University Libraries", and "Copyright in School and College Libraries". The "LA Copyright Guides" comprise six sectoral guides interpreting the main provisions of the 1988 Copyright Act affecting libraries and information units. These guidleines have been compiled by The Library Association's copyright experts, and have been fully revised to include details of European and government copyright legislation of: term of protection (duration); computer software; lending and rental; and protection of databases. The copyright implications of using audiovisual material and works in electronic form (eg CD-ROM, Internet material) are covered in each of the guides. Special advice is given on how to stay legal and there is a completely new section on relevant case law. Each guide introduces the reader to the basics of copyright, clarifying the complexities of copyright restrictions, and how to work within the exceptions, such as copying under library regulations and fair dealing. The miscellaneous advice section in each guide contains revised and updated guidance to help librarians cope with the full range of copyright issues facing them. Appendices include lists of useful addresses and further reading, as well as a sample declaration form.
